What should we do when a CFB boiler encounters a cyclone separator breakdown?
When a Circulating Fluidized Bed (CFB) boiler encounters a cyclone separator breakdown, it's important to address the issue promptly and effectively to maintain the boiler's efficiency and safety. Here are steps that should be taken:
Immediate Shutdown: First and foremost, shut down the boiler following the standard shutdown procedures. This is crucial to prevent any further damage to the boiler and to ensure safety.
Inspection and Diagnosis: Once the boiler is safely shut down, conduct a thorough inspection of the cyclone separator to identify the exact cause of the breakdown. Common issues might include wear and tear, blockages, or mechanical failures.
Repair or Replacement: Based on the inspection, decide whether the cyclone separator can be repaired or needs to be replaced. For minor issues, repairs might suffice, but in case of major damage, replacement might be necessary.
Consult with Experts: If the cause of the breakdown is not immediately apparent or if the repair process is complex, it might be wise to consult with a boiler specialist or the manufacturer. They can provide expert advice on the best course of action.
Implement Corrective Measures: Once the problem is identified, implement the necessary corrective measures. This might include repairing or replacing parts, clearing blockages, or making adjustments to the system.
Preventive Maintenance: To prevent future occurrences, review and enhance your preventive maintenance schedule. Regular maintenance and inspections can often catch small issues before they lead to a breakdown.
System Testing: After the repairs or replacement, test the system thoroughly to ensure that it is operating correctly and efficiently. Monitor the performance of the cyclone separator closely for some time to ensure the issue has been fully resolved.
Documentation and Review: Document the breakdown, the steps taken to resolve it, and any changes made to the system or procedures. This information can be valuable for future reference and for understanding the long-term performance and maintenance needs of the boiler.
Training and Awareness: Ensure that the operating staff is trained and aware of the signs of potential issues with the cyclone separator. An informed and vigilant team can play a crucial role in preventing breakdowns.
Safety Protocols: Always prioritize safety during the entire process. Ensure that all safety protocols and guidelines are strictly followed to protect the staff and the facility.
Remember, addressing a cyclone separator breakdown in a CFB boiler is a complex task that often requires technical expertise and should always be approached with safety as the top priority.
